Output 23ef40d27c103bfc0aafaa8719bd917a2d67ec64a29ab435229c0046c4e1e89c:5

value
43453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edb701209fdea861d897817af85c26ec7cc2a5e8 OP_EQUAL
address
3PMwJNni1Zg9fiNMAu2TNfUoHKScMYRPXd
transaction
23ef40d27c103bfc0aafaa8719bd917a2d67ec64a29ab435229c0046c4e1e89c
spent
true